Call now for assistance: 866-206-0994. Visit our 360 … WebGranite: Most will agree that taking care of granite is much easier when compared to taking care of a marble countertop. Marble and granite are both porous materials which means that you need to always clean up the spills if you have any. Just remember that the effects from spills are a lot less harsh on a granite countertop. Marble:

Call now for assistance: 866-206-0994 WebApr 13, 2024 · Price. Both marble and granite are considered high-end kitchen countertop materials, although granite is slightly cheaper than marble, depending on the quality of the slab. The average price of granite is $40-$100 per square foot, compared to $50-$150 per square foot for marble. Countertops typically make up about 10% of your overall kitchen ...
